On his 43rd birthday, Yuvraj Singh is celebrated as cricket aficionados reminisce about a monumental chapter in the sport's history—his spectacular six sixes in an over during the 2007 T20 World Cup. The former Indian all-rounder, who made his debut in 2000 and hung up his boots in 2019, played 398 international matches and accrued over 11,000 runs, cementing a legacy marked by exceptional performances.

Yuvraj's unforgettable innings unfolded on September 19, 2007, at Kingsmead, where he executed a sensational display against England’s Stuart Broad. With remarkable power and precision, he launched six consecutive sixes, reaching his half-century in a mere 12 balls—a T20 record that remains unbroken. His breathtaking assault helped India set a daunting target of 218 runs, ultimately clinching an 18-run win.

India emerged victorious at the inaugural T20 World Cup, with Yuvraj playing a pivotal role throughout the tournament. His excellence continued in the 2011 ODI World Cup, where he exhibited one of the finest all-round displays in cricket, accumulating 362 runs, taking 15 wickets, earning four Man of the Match honors, and claiming the prestigious Player of the Tournament award.

In his career spanning 304 ODIs, 58 T20Is, and 40 Tests, Yuvraj established himself as a game-changer through his aggressive batting, sharp fielding, and timely bowling breakthroughs. Even after retiring in 2019, he remains a lasting emblem of resilience and charisma in Indian cricket.
